100g of ciabatta roll contain about 298 calories (kcal).
Calories per: ounce | one ciabatta roll | slice

To give you an idea, a medium size ciabatta roll (80 g) contain about 238 calories.

This is about 12% of the daily caloric intake for an average adult with medium weight and activity level (assuming a 2000 kcal daily intake).

Discover the Nutritional Value of a Ciabatta Roll

When it comes to choosing bread, the Ciabatta roll stands out for its delightful texture and rich flavor. Originating from Italy, this popular bread has become a staple in sandwiches, making it a favorite worldwide. But beyond its taste and versatility, understanding the Ciabatta roll calories and nutrition is essential for those mindful of their dietary intake. Let's dive into the nutritional profile of a Ciabatta roll and see how it fits into a healthy diet.

Calories and Macronutrients

A typical Ciabatta roll contains approximately 298 calories. When it comes to macronutrients, it provides a balanced mix, with a significant portion coming from carbs. Here's a breakdown:

  • Carbohydrates: 58.7g, with 2g of fiber, making it a substantial source of energy.
  • Protein in Ciabatta roll: 8.7g, contributing to muscle repair and growth.
  • Fat in Ciabatta roll: 3.6g, with 0.61g of saturated fat, which is relatively low and makes it a healthier option.

Vitamins and Minerals

While Ciabatta rolls are not a significant source of vitamins, they do contain small amounts of essential minerals that contribute to overall health:

  • Calcium: 16mg - Important for bone health.
  • Iron: 1.2mg - Crucial for blood production.
  • Magnesium: 21mg, Phosphorus: 81mg, and Potassium: 124mg - Support various bodily functions including heart rhythm, muscle contractions, and nerve signaling.
  • Sodium: 516mg - While necessary, it's important to consume in moderation to maintain healthy blood pressure levels.

Role in a Healthy Diet

Given its nutritional profile, a Ciabatta roll can fit into a balanced diet when consumed mindfully. The key is to pay attention to portion sizes and how it's paired with other foods. For instance, stuffing a Ciabatta with lean proteins, healthy fats, and plenty of vegetables can make for a nutritious and satisfying meal. However, due to its higher carb content and sodium levels, those monitoring their carbohydrate intake or with dietary restrictions should consider these factors.
